Villa "The Garden of Rocco"

Charming cottage surrounded by centuries-old olive grove with wonderful views of the sea and the surrounding hills. Arranged on two levels, it consists of a living area with double sofa bed, kitchen and bathroom on the ground floor; 2 double bedrooms with large terrace and bathroom on the upper floor. 2 Km away from the real inhabited center and 4 Km from the sea, an oasis of peace where you can spend relaxing moments equipped with every comfort. The house is located in Badolato, a suggestive medieval village overlooking the Ionian Sea. The village houses 14 churches of strong architectural and historical-cultural interest. Just adjacent to the house is the Madonna della Sanità Sanctuary (10th century), a few hundred meters away from the fascinating Convent of the Angels which today houses the MondoX community. The area is suitable for wonderful bicycle excursions, trekking routes, visits to the village and surrounding villages, waterfalls and nature trails in the nearby mountainous area and the uncontaminated coast of the Ionian Sea. Of great interest are our food and wine traditions to which you are invited to participate as a harvest (early September), olive harvest and extra virgin olive oil production (end of September-October), cured meat processing (December-January) as well as the suggestive religious traditions, first of all the Easter week. Gorgeous peaceful mountain cottage overlooking the Ionian Sea.
My wife and I and her sister and husband traveled from Rome to Pompeii to Matera to Otsuni and to this cottage in Badolato all on a two week trip. All were two bedroom and two bath with kitchen VRBO rentals and this was our favorite. Very quite and peaceful on the mountain side just east of Badolato with amazing views of the mountains and ocean. There are trails through the olive groves, roads leading to interesting ruins, a vacant Convent next door, and gorgeous views. Very peaceful. Fabrizio left us a bottle of his great homemade wine. We explored the ancient villages of Badolato and Davoli. We enjoyed the nearby seashores. We spent one day just relaxing at the cottage, cooking our own meals, and taking an occasional hike. The views from the massive upstairs balcony were amazing. This is our third Italy trip and we have enjoyed staying at several Agritourismo lodgings and in small village rentals and this is our favorite.
